We show how transverse momentum dependent gluon distributions could be probed at a future Electron-Ion Collider through the analysis of transverse momentum spectra and azimuthal asymmetries in the inclusive electroproduction of J/ψ and Υ mesons. The maximum values of these asymmetries, obtained in a model-independent way by imposing the positivity bounds of the polarized gluon distributions, suggest the feasibility of the proposed measurements.
